- 小程序中组件化开发说明:
1.先编写组件
2.js文件对应的pages({})变成了component({})
3.有对应的properties:{},可以接受外来数据
4.关于事件:this.triggerEvent(‘radioChange’,this.data.radioObj),
通过this.triggerEvent触发父组件中的方法
使用时:
1.usingComponents在json文件中,对应的usingComponents中添加组件路径
2.在组件中调用。 - 在小程序中调用其他h5页面
用webview组件 - 小程序中跳转其他小程序
- 在project.config.json中可以配置小程序启动页面,主要是供开发时调试使用,
- 在小程序中使用模板片段
<!--wxml-->
<template name="staffName">
<view>
FirstName: {{firstName}}, LastName: {{lastName}}
</view>
</template>
<template is="staffName" data="{{...staffA}}"></template>
<template is="staffName" data="{{...staffB}}"></template>
<template is="staffName" data="{{...staffC}}"></template>
// page.js
Page({
data: {
staffA: {firstName: 'Hulk', lastName: 'Hu'},
staffB: {firstName: 'Shang', lastName: 'You'},
staffC: {firstName: 'Gideon', lastName: 'Lin'}
}
})
在某个.wxml文件中使用template片段时需要先引入
<import src="../common/header.wxml" />